Oil cooler fitment?

I have one of the form members selling me a oil cooler of a 94 touring Fd.(drivers side) I have a 93 touring with as u know only has one oil cooler. I want the 2nd one like the r1's but would a touring (drivers side) fit into the passenger side slot with some modification? oil cooler lines, etc?

Probably not. Lines in wrong place, brackets in wrong place, thermostat to remove, etc. It seems that it would be much easier just to get the right stock part, or use an aftermarket cooler like a Mocal or Setrab.
